AM> Is there any way of telling bink that you want to freq a whole heap of
 AM> files from one or more places, rather than pressing ALT-G and having to
 AM> type in address, filename, password (if from TML) and answer 'yes I am
 AM> sure' over and over again?

No.  However, if you use Squish to do it, you can use the command recall
and overtype the command.  I suggest a different method to both.  Go into
Binkley and do it on one file, and then go and have a look on your hard
disk for a file called something-or-other, and then edit that, and then
stick as many filenames as you want (one per line).

 AM> Do I ever need to type anything into the password field, for that
 AM> matter, even on your bbs, if I'm just after a file, no mail?

Only if I password-protect a particular file.  I have no password-protected
files on this BBS.  BFN.
